Notes Applicable to all Programs Offered by the Department of Mathematics and Statistics
- The Department offers an Honours Mathematics and Statistics program, which, may be complemented with a Specialization in Mathematics, Statistics, or Origins Research and an Honours Actuarial and Financial Mathematics program. Combined Honours programs are available with Arts and Science, Biology, Computer Science, Economics, Philosophy, and Physics.
- Students considering graduate studies in Mathematics are encouraged to complete MATH 2XX3 , MATH 3A03 , MATH 3E03 , MATH 3F03 , MATH 3X03 , MATH 4A03 or register in the Mathematics Specialization. Students considering graduate studies in Statistics are encouraged to complete STATS 3A03 , STATS 3D03 , STATS 3F03* , STATS 3S03 , STATS 3U03 or register in the Statistics Specialization. Students considering a career as an actuary are encouraged to complete MATH 2FM3 , MATH 3FM3 , MATH 4FM3 , STATS 2D03 , STATS 2MB3 , STATS 3A03 , STATS 3D03 , STATS 3G03 , STATS 3H03* , STATS 4A03* or register in Honours Actuarial and Financial Mathematics.
- Cooperative Education programs are available; see the requirements for Honours Mathematics and Statistics Co-op programs in this section of the Calendar. Admission to the co-op programs is in Level III.
